Materials Used in Bubble Chandeliers

The materials used in bubble chandeliers play a significant role in their design and durability.

  1. Glass: Many bubble chandeliers use hand-blown glass for their elegant and transparent appearance. Glass bubbles are durable and add a luxurious feel to the fixture.
  2. Acrylic: Acrylic bubbles offer a lighter, shatter-resistant alternative to glass. They also often come in a variety of colors.
  3. Metal Fixtures: Most bubble chandeliers use strong metals, such as stainless steel or brass, for the frame. These materials support the bubbles and provide a sleek finish.
  4. Lighting Components: LED bulbs are commonly integrated due to their energy efficiency and long-lasting performance. In some cases, halogen or incandescent bulbs may also be used.

The combination of these materials ensures that the chandeliers are functional, durable, and stylish.

Installation Tips for Bubble Pendants

Installing a bubble chandelier requires careful planning to ensure safety and aesthetic appeal. Proper placement and wiring enhance functionality and visual impact in your home.

Proper Placement and Height Guidelines

  1. Central Placement: Place the chandelier in the center of the room for balance and focus.
  2. Room Function: Adjust placement to suit the space, like dining tables or living room seating.
  3. Height From Floor: Hang the chandelier at least 7 feet above the floor for comfortable clearance.
  4. Ceiling Height Consideration: High ceilings allow longer drops, while low ceilings need compact designs.
  5. Distance from Furniture: Ensure at least 30 inches between the chandelier and furniture for a clean look.

Wiring and Safety Considerations

  1. Professional Installation: Hire an electrician for safe wiring and secure mounting.
  2. Weight Support: Ensure the ceiling or mounting point can support the chandelier’s weight.
  3. Use Proper Hardware: Choose the right brackets and screws for stability.
  4. Check Wiring: Inspect wiring for damages and use energy-efficient bulbs.
  5. Turn Off Power: Always switch off electricity when working with wiring to avoid accidents.

Maintenance and Cleaning Tips for Bubble Pendants

Proper maintenance keeps your bubble chandelier looking stunning. Cleaning it regularly extends its life and preserves its appeal. Follow these tips to ensure your chandelier remains a highlight in your home.

Routine Cleaning Methods

  1. Dust Regularly: Use a feather duster or microfiber cloth to remove dust and debris weekly.
  2. Use Mild Cleaners: Opt for a gentle glass cleaner to avoid damaging delicate surfaces.
  3. Spot Clean: Tackle stains on bubbles carefully with a damp, soft cloth and mild soap.
  4. Avoid Excess Moisture: Never soak the chandelier to prevent damage to lighting components and fixtures.
  5. Polish Metals: Wipe metal parts with a dry cloth to maintain their shine.
  6. Check Lights: Inspect and clean bulbs to ensure they remain bright and functional.

Regular upkeep is simple and keeps your bubble chandelier elegant and radiant.

Handling Glass Components Safely

  1. Turn Off Power: Ensure the chandelier is off to avoid electrical accidents.
  2. Use a Stable Ladder: Always work on a secure ladder to clean or adjust the chandelier.
  3. Wear Gloves: Wear cotton gloves to handle glass bubbles to avoid leaving fingerprints.
  4. Detach Components Carefully: If needed, remove parts for cleaning gently to prevent breakage.
  5. Inspect for Cracks: Regularly check glass for chips or cracks and replace if needed.
  6. Reassemble Properly: Ensure all components are secured before turning the chandelier back on.
